Transaction 51d9f01d6ab3eb77488991346afb8d89eba3e507ab44078cbf7196a6cc31fe61
1 Input
1 Output
-
51d9f01d6ab3eb77488991346afb8d89eba3e507ab44078cbf7196a6cc31fe61:0
- value
- 383301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6badbeb2b54a76fbf7be6a58b6dd81687c965379 OP_EQUAL
- address
- 3BWNN5UJ3CQtiCXQoeRVFYWLFh7bsQ14of